Tuning Mesoporous Silica Films Accessibility Through Controlled Dissolution in NH 4 F: Investigation of Structural Change by Ellipsometry Porosimetry and X-ray Reflectivity

Résumé

In this work, we present a method to accurately increase the porosity of mesoporous silica films using a postsynthesis controlled partial dissolution in dilute NH4F aqueous solutions. This investigation was performed on around 100 nm thick films prepared by sol–gel chemistry and evaporation-induced self-assembly with various classical micellar templating agents. The evolution of the pore size, the pore interconnection size, the pore organization, and the film thickness were followed by ellipsometry porosimetry and X-ray reflectivity along the dissolution process. We show that the dissolution always proceeds in two well-distinct steps. First, the dissolution provokes the increase of the pore volume, with increasing pore and interconnection sizes, without modification of the structure and the thickness. Then, the collapse of the porous network leads to the reduction of the porosity and the thickness, confirming that a critical maximal porosity can be obtained with each of these systems. The dissolution kinetics, studied in different conditions of chemical attack, revealed that the dissolution follows a linear tendency in each case, facilitating the control over the porosity tuning. Finally, a mechanism for a sol–gel-based mesoporous silica dissolution mechanism is proposed. Overall, a convenient method to increase the pore size without damaging the pore structure is proposed
